Origins and Background

Created by writer/artist Jim Starlin, Gamora first appeared in “Strange Tales” #180 in June 1975. She is the last surviving member of the Zen-Whoberi species, whose extermination varies between comic storylines. In her original timeline, the Universal Church of Truth wiped out her people, while in other versions, it was the alien race known as the Badoon.

Thanos, the Mad Titan, found Gamora as a child and decided to use her as a weapon. He raised and trained her to be an assassin, showing little kindness during her childhood. Despite this, Gamora remained loyal to Thanos, who promised her the opportunity to avenge her family’s death.

Abilities and Skills

Gamora’s intensive training and cybernetic enhancements have made her an exceptionally deadly warrior. She possesses:

  1. Superhuman strength and agility
  2. Accelerated healing factor
  3. Elite combat skills

These abilities have earned her the title “The Deadliest Woman in the Whole Galaxy”. Her proficiency in various alien martial arts disciplines further cements her status as one of the most formidable fighters in the Marvel Universe.

Notable Storylines

Infinity Watch and Adam Warlock

Gamora played a significant role in cosmic storylines involving Adam Warlock and the Infinity Gems. She became a member of the Infinity Watch, a group tasked with safeguarding the powerful Infinity Stones. Her relationship with Adam Warlock is particularly noteworthy, as he once saved her soul using the Soul Gem when she was struck down by Thanos.

Annihilation and Guardians of the Galaxy

Gamora featured prominently in the “Annihilation” crossover event, which led to her joining the modern iteration of the Guardians of the Galaxy. This team, including Star-Lord, Rocket Raccoon, and Groot, would go on to become fan favorites and eventually inspire the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U) adaptations.

The Godslayer

In the comics, Gamora wields a powerful sword called the Godslayer. Given to her by Thanos in 2006, this weapon is capable of harming even the most powerful beings in the universe, including Thanos himself.

Marvel Cinematic Universe

Gamora’s popularity soared with her inclusion in the MCU, where she is portrayed by Zoe Saldaña. The films explore her complex relationship with Thanos, her adopted sister Nebula, and her romantic involvement with Peter Quill (Star-Lord).

In the MCU, Gamora’s character arc involves:

  1. Betraying Thanos and joining the Guardians of the Galaxy
  2. Developing a romantic relationship with Peter Quill
  3. Being sacrificed by Thanos to obtain the Soul Stone
  4. An alternate version from 2014 joining the present-day MCU timeline

Saldaña’s portrayal has been praised for bringing depth and nuance to the character, making Gamora a fan favorite in the franchise.

Character Analysis

Gamora is characterized by her seriousness, focus, and sense of honor. Despite her deadly skills, she is haunted by the atrocities she committed under Thanos’s command. This internal conflict drives her to seek redemption and use her abilities for good.

Her journey from ruthless assassin to heroic Guardian showcases themes of redemption, family (both blood and chosen), and the struggle to overcome one’s past. These elements make Gamora a compelling and relatable character despite her extraordinary background and abilities.
